Definition of transpose

Transpose (v. t.) To bring, as any term of an equation, from one side over to the other, without destroying the equation; thus, if a + b = c, and we make a = c - b, then b is said to be transposed..

Transpose :: Transpose (v. t.) To change; to transform; to invert.
Transelementate :: Transelementate (v. t.) To change or transpose the elements of; to transubstantiate.
Transposed :: Transposed (imp. & p. p.) of Transpos.
Hyperbatic :: Hyperbatic (a.) Of or pertaining to an hyperbaton; transposed; inverted.
Antimetabole :: Antimetabole (n.) A figure in which the same words or ideas are repeated in transposed order.
Transpose :: Transpose (v. t.) To change the key of.
Transposition :: Transposition (n.) The act of transposing, or the state of being transposed..
Transposal :: Transposal (n.) The act of transposing, or the state of being transposed; transposition..
Transpose :: Transpose (v. t.) To change the place or order of; to substitute one for the other of; to exchange, in respect of position; as, to transpose letters, words, or propositions..
Transposer :: Transposer (n.) One who transposes.
Transposable :: Transposable (a.) That may transposed; as, a transposable phrase..
Transpose :: Transpose (v. t.) To change the natural order of, as words..
